Source: Marianas Variety
Parliament is about to vote whether to reintroduce austerity Fridays, whereby government offices close every other Friday, and employees who do not work on official CNMI holidays are not be paid for that day.
Public Law 15-24, of 2007, already mandated the biweekly austerity holidays, but it expired on September 30, 2007.
